Oklahoma's tax-free weekend is scheduled for August 2-4, 2024, marking a period when certain clothing and footwear priced below $100 will be exempt from sales tax. This exemption applies to state, city, county, and local municipality sales taxes, encouraging residents to shop for back-to-school items or update their wardrobes. All retailers in the state are mandated to participate, offering a substantial saving opportunity for shoppers.
For additional details, including a comprehensive list of exempt items and answers to frequently asked questions like the use of coupons and online shopping eligibility, interested individuals are encouraged to visit the Oklahoma Tax Commission website.
